Product Definition:
Radiation oncology is the branch of medicine that uses radiation to treat cancer. Radiation therapy destroys cancer cells by damaging their DNA. It can be used to treat cancers that have spread throughout the body (metastatic cancer) or tumors that are only in one area.

Brachytherapy:
Brachytherapy is the practice of placing radioactive materials inside a patient's body. The most common form of brachytherapy involves placing sources in the prostate, lungs, liver or breast area. Growth Factors:
- Increasing incidence of cancer: The increasing incidence of cancer is the major growth driver for radiation oncology market. According to the World Health Organization (WHO), there were 14 million new cases of cancer and 8.2 million deaths from cancer in 2012 worldwide, and it is estimated that these numbers will increase to 21 million new cases and 13 million deaths by 2030. This will create a huge demand for radiation oncology services, which will drive the growth of this market.
